I would suggest looking for a dental HMO insurance plan such as Pacificare, GoldenWest, or Delta Dental. Since there is no difference between choosing a dentist off a company provider data base or picking on out of the phone book.
Since you are not locked into trying to stay with a dental office why pay more to have a plan that will let you choose your own dentist with all the other limitations that come with them.
When choosing a dentist out of a net work or phone book do your homework first. Call them up. Make sure their hours, booking appointments and their services all make scene to you. You can even stop by the dental office just to check it out before making that final decision.
